CRIMES (SEXUAL OFFENCES) ACT 2006 (NO 2 OF 2006) - SECT 37

New section 37E inserted

After section 37D of the Evidence Act 1958 insert

        "37E.     Evidence of specialised knowledge in certain cases

        Despite any rule of law to the contrary, in any legal proceeding that relates (wholly or partly) to a charge for a sexual offence, the court may receive evidence of a person's opinion that is based on that person's specialised knowledge (acquired through training, study or experience) of—

        (a)     the nature of sexual offences; and

        (b)     the social, psychological and cultural factors that may affect the behaviour of a person who has been the victim, or who alleges that he or she has been the victim, of a sexual offence, including the reasons that may contribute to a delay on the part of the victim to report the offence.".
